mysql 8.0.11安装配置方法图文教程

作者:咸鱼塘塘主 时间:2024-01-27 17:22:08 

MySQL8.0的安装及配置方法,供大家参考,具体内容如下

下载:先上网站

在这个网站中找到

mysql 8.0.11安装配置方法图文教程

下载完成后解压缩到你需要的路径

MySQL配置

然后在解压的文件夹里面新建

my.ini文件


[mysqld]
# 设置3306端口
port=3306
# 设置mysql的安装目录
basedir=C:\\JavaEnvironment\mysql-8.0.11-winx64
# 设置mysql数据库的数据的存放目录
datadir=C:\\JavaEnvironment\mysql-8.0.11-winx64\\data
# 允许最大连接数
max_connections=200
# 允许连接失败的次数。这是为了防止有人从该主机试图攻击数据库系统
max_connect_errors=10000
# 服务端使用的字符集默认为UTF8
character-set-server=utf8
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
wait_timeout=31536000
interactive_timeout=31536000

#sql_mode=ONLY_FULL_GROUP_BY,STRICT_TRANS_TABLES,ERROR_FOR_DIVISION_BY_ZERO,N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ION
[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8

[client]
# 设置mysql客户端连接服务端时默认使用的端口
port=3306
default-character-set=utf8

把上面的代码粘贴进去
此处需要注意


# 设置mysql的安装目录
basedir=C:\\JavaEnvironment\mysql-8.0.11-winx64
# 设置mysql数据库的数据的存放目录
datadir=C:\\JavaEnvironment\mysql-8.0.11-winx64\\data

这两行要根据你的mysql位置进行变更

环境变量的配置

然后配置环境变量

mysql 8.0.11安装配置方法图文教程

然后在Path中配置

mysql 8.0.11安装配置方法图文教程

MySQL服务初始化

接下来开始安装喽
在CMD下运行


mysqld --initialize --user=mysql --console

可以看到

mysql 8.0.11安装配置方法图文教程

务必记住这个初始密码,一会需要用这个初始密码登录mysql修改密码
如果emm你把他点没了 你只要把datadir配置的那个data的文件删除了,然后重新执行初始化即可

然后输入


mysqld --install

进行服务注册。
再打开服务(此处需要用管理员权限运行cmd)


net start mysql

然后就开始愉快的玩耍了

修改默认密码


mysql -u root -p

登录mysql 然后输出初始的那个密码
接下来来修改密码


ALTER USER "root"@"localhost" IDENTIFIED BY "123456";

此时密码就被初始化成123456了。

其他

如果在使用数据库连接工具连接的时候出现错误,可以尝试在my.ini配置文件中的mysqld后面加上


default_authentication_plugin=mysql_native_password

虽然不知道为什么,反正加上就对了。

来源:https://blog.csdn.net/qq_38345606/article/details/80641544

标签:mysql8.0,mysql8.0.11
0
投稿

猜你喜欢

  • Python使用numpy模块实现矩阵和列表的连接操作方法

    2023-02-17 21:05:41
  • 了解一下python内建模块collections

    2022-03-19 08:32:37
  • python 5个实用的技巧

    2022-12-23 14:17:05
  • python修改全局变量可以不加global吗?

    2021-01-11 08:10:56
  • Python基于有道实现英汉字典功能

    2021-05-23 19:35:57
  • MySQL和MongoDB设计实例对比

    2011-06-19 15:41:01
  • python简单程序读取串口信息的方法

    2024-01-02 02:42:18
  • Python Pillow Image Invert

    2023-10-02 12:33:30
  • asp如何将数字转化成条形图?

    2009-12-03 20:19:00
  • Linux下通过python获取本机ip方法示例

    2023-02-18 05:56:15
  • mysql8.0.0 winx64.zip解压版安装配置教程

    2024-01-12 23:38:27
  • laravel 实现阿里云oss文件上传功能的示例

    2023-06-13 20:39:26
  • Python 中的参数传递、返回值、浅拷贝、深拷贝

    2022-10-12 12:59:16
  • Python "手绘风格"数据可视化方法实例汇总

    2023-01-30 03:12:23
  • Pytorch通过保存为ONNX模型转TensorRT5的实现

    2023-10-22 13:45:27
  • Python使用tkinter制作在线翻译软件

    2021-04-19 10:36:06
  • Js实现粘贴上传图片的原理及示例

    2024-04-19 10:44:50
  • Python机器学习性能度量利用鸢尾花数据绘制P-R曲线

    2023-01-27 20:55:48
  • Python实现改变与矩形橡胶的线条的颜色代码示例

    2022-08-02 08:16:26
  • Python中可变和不可变对象的深入讲解

    2022-12-29 21:31:21
  • asp之家 网络编程 m.aspxhome.com